What plant can repel rodents?

What plant can repel rodents? First, you can plant herbs around your garden, sort of like a protective wall to repel rodents. Herbs that have the strongest smells such as mint (especially peppermint), catnip, rosemary, sage, lavender, oregano, and basil are the most effective plants at keeping these unwelcome creatures away.

What are examples of paratenic host? Guinea pigs are paratenic hosts of B. procyonis and contract infection by ingesting eggs in raccoon feces (Baker, 2007). Once ingested, larvae will hatch and penetrate the small intestine of the guinea pig, migrate through the liver to the lungs and disseminate throughout the body via the circulatory system.

Why does facetime keep opening on my mac?

If FaceTime is opening itself automatically when an inbound FaceTime call comes to the Mac, you can stop this by turning off FaceTime on the Mac. The easiest way to turn off FaceTime on Mac is by going to the FaceTime app and pulling down the “FaceTime” menu and choosing ‘Turn FaceTime Off’.

Does Mac Mini have AirPlay?

Note that ‌AirPlay‌ to Mac only works with the 2018 or later MacBook Pro or MacBook Air, 2019 or later iMac or Mac Pro, the ‌iMac‌ Pro, and the 2020 or later Mac mini. You’ll also need your iOS devices to be running iOS 15 or later: You can check in on your device by going into Settings -> General -> Software Update).

What are all considered rodents?

Chipmunks, marmots, woodchucks, squirrels, prairie dogs and gophers belong to one rodent group. Another group includes common house mice, rats, gerbils, hamsters, lemmings and voles. Another well known group contains porcupines, capybaras, agouti, guinea pigs and chinchillas.
